**Q: Why did my document stop rendering in Inkmill?**

A: The Inkmill markdown pipeline sanitizes raw HTML and rejects documents over 2 MB. Check the render log in the Quarry dashboard first; most failures are oversized embeds. If the sanitizer cache itself is corrupted, a cache reset is needed, and the reset tool asks for the recovery passphrase below.

recovery phrase for bafof-kajof: quenmir-ralmir-praeth

## Spreadsheet Exports and Memory

The Ledgerline export service builds spreadsheets in memory before streaming them, so large exports from the Quarrow reporting tenant can spike heap usage fast. If you get paged for OOM kills on an export worker, check the row count on the active job first — anything over two million rows should have been routed to the batch tier. Do not raise the memory limit as a fix; that just delays the crash. The escalation checklist and historical incident notes are kept on the internal page linked below.

runbook for badug-kadup: https://confluence.zemvarlabs.internal/projects/browse/display/projects/bd1b

Runbook — NightLedger inventory reconciliation. If the 02:00 job reports a delta above 0.5% between warehouse counts and ledger totals, do not re-run immediately; a second pass can double-apply adjustments. First confirm the upstream sync from the Brindlemoor depot finished, then check for stuck rows in the adjustments queue. If the queue is clear, snapshot the delta report and re-run with the dry-run flag. Any escalation to the data team must quote the job trace shown below.

pipeline stamp: htk21_4adfc7a400dc735eb9849

# Lanternware Component Library — Version Quotas

The shared Lanternware component library publishes on a fixed cadence. To keep the registry manageable, we cap retained versions per package and throttle publish frequency. Releases beyond quota require a retention exception approved before cut day. Deprecated majors are pruned automatically after the grace window. Current quota constants are defined as follows.

tuning table, kajog-bawip:
TIERS = {
    "kelius": 256,
    "lammir": 543,
}